Bio
Vicki was born in a minister’s family, where she wrote and sang her first song at the age of 5. At the young age of 17, Vicki entered bible school, and after two years, at the age of 19, she accepted a Music Director’s position near Baton Rouge, Louisiana. It was during that time that Vicki recorded her first project. Soon after finishing that debut recording, ministry invitations increased to the point that Vicki sensed God was leading her down a new path of ministry. In 1994, Vicki released three projects that included such hits as: “The Mercy Seat,” “Under The Blood,” and “Something About My Praise.” Her debut release with PureSprings Gospel, “I Just Want You,” included the hit “Because of Who You Are,” which earned Vicki her first nomination for Gospel Music’s Dove Award. Vicki’s 10th cd entitled, “I’m at Peace” was recorded live in Nashville as she celebrated 20 years in full time ministry. Vicki’s latest project entitled “Free Worshipper” was released August 2013. Vicki makes time for missions work by ministering in various parts of Africa, Europe and Asia. Vicki Yohe Ministries opened New Destiny for Children, an orphanage in Jinja, Uganda for children orphaned by the AIDS epidemic. Vicki lives in Nashville, Tennessee and enjoys working out and the company of her sons Walker and Adley, and nephew Houston.
